Motherhood Quote by Sheena Easton

"I'm terrible at relationships. I consider myself to be smart and a good mother, but it's taken me this long to realise you don't have to marry a guy after three days or dump him"

About this Quote

A pop star admitting romantic incompetence is usually packaged as confession-for-sale. Sheena Easton’s version lands differently: it’s blunt, funny, and almost stubbornly unglamorous. “I’m terrible at relationships” doesn’t beg for sympathy; it clears the stage so she can puncture a bigger myth - that being “smart” and being a “good mother” should automatically translate into emotional wisdom. The tension is the point. She’s naming the cultural bait-and-switch where competence in public life gets treated as proof you must have it together in private, then shaming you when you don’t.

The punchline is in the extremes: “marry a guy after three days or dump him.” Easton compresses a whole era of romantic scripts into two impulsive options, the fairy-tale fast-track or the scorched-earth exit. That binary is what she’s really diagnosing: not her “terribleness,” but a learned impatience, the pressure to make relationships produce certainty immediately. The phrase “taken me this long” carries the sting of hindsight - a middle-aged clarity that feels both liberating and slightly ridiculous, as if the lesson was obvious but socially obscured.

Context matters because Easton came up in a celebrity ecosystem that rewarded decisive narratives: whirlwind romances, dramatic breakups, clean story arcs that could fit in a headline. Her insight is small on purpose. She’s not offering a grand theory of love; she’s reclaiming the quiet middle space most people actually live in, where you can date, hesitate, renegotiate, and not turn every infatuation into a life sentence.
